If i crank the torsion bars to make it level with back on my 04 silverado 1500.... WILL 295/75/16's FIT??

 

On stock wheels, yes they will fit, I have a friend runnung 305's.

 

 

Yeah, but are they 75 series?

 

 

They are 305/70R-16 Maxxis Bighorns which are 33x12.4x16 which is not much different than a 295/75R-16 which is 33.4x11.6x16.

 

I know people that run 315's with just a leveling kit and a small amount of trimming, of course this is on stock wheels.

 

I wish it was that easy on the GMT-900's

 

Oh and there is a guy on our hunting club running 34x10.50x16LT Super Swampers on his with TB crank and no trimming that I know of but I can ask.
